Did Gronk sit out a year?
Rob Gronkowski announced his retirement two and a half years ago and sat out the 2019 season, but when his friend Tom Brady signed with the Buccaneers in 2020, Gronk came out of retirement to facilitate a trade from the Patriots to the Bucs. He has no regrets.
How many times did Gronk retire?
Gronkowski, 32, has already retired once. He called it quits after the 2018 NFL season, his ninth with the Patriots, and spent 2019 out of football. However, Tom Brady lured him back to the NFL and convinced him to play for the Bucs, where he has spent each of the last two seasons.

Who was the oldest rookie in the NFL?
Ola Kimrin (Sweden), a placekicker, played in five games at 32 years old for the Washington Redskins, during the 2004 season, becoming the oldest rookie ever to play in an NFL game.

Who was the oldest player to ever be drafted in the NFL?
#1 – Oldest – Ove Johansson
Yes, you read that correctly. Johansson was drafted by the Houston Oilers in the 12th round of the 1977 draft. He was the oldest player ever to be drafted and the first Swedish player to be drafted as well. It would be another 12 years before any more Swedes joined the NFL.

What was Gronk's bonus?
Thanks to a huge performance on Sunday afternoon, Rob Gronkowski will get to cash in a $1 million bonus check. The Buccaneers tight end had seven receptions for 137 yards in Tampa Bay's 41-17 win over the Carolina Panthers on Sunday, which earned him a pair of $500,000 contract incentives.
